AR Homework Club

Position Overview:

The Homework Club offered at the Alum Rock Library is an important service that has grown over time. Managed by an on-site club coordinator, the Homework Club is looking for several high-school students and/or adults interested in volunteering on a weekly basis to assist local students with homework and provide a safe space for families after school.

Responsibilities (with the support of the Homework Club Coordinator):

  • Help students in grades K-8 understand their homework in a range of subjects including reading, writing, math, social studies, and science
  • Help students individually and in small groups
  • Manage Homework Club store and award students "brain bucks" for participation and hard work

Benefits:

  • Satisfaction of making an important difference in students’ learning and success in school
  • Learn ways to coach, promote learning, and refine teaching skills
  • Gain experience to add to a resume or college application

Training/Support Available: The Homework Coaches will be provided with an online training course as well as an in-person training provided by library staff after registering as a volunteer.

Qualifications:

  • Prior experience tutoring is a plus but not required
  • Must have the requisite basic skills to support students in grades K-8. This can be strength in one subject area or general knowledge.
  • Experience or interest working with students/youth
  • Patience, flexibility
  • Second language ability is a plus

Commitment: Homework Tutors are needed on either Tuesdays or Wednesday from 3:45 pm to 6:00 pm (schedule somewhat flexible upon request); volunteers are asked to commit to a minimum of one semester as a tutor.

Mission Statement

San Jose Public Library enriches lives by fostering lifelong learning and by ensuring that every member of the community has access to a vast array of ideas and information. San Jose Public Library is a winner of the 2011 National Medal for Museum and Library Service, the nation’s highest honor for museums and libraries. Recipients are selected because of their innovative approaches to public service and the contribution they make to the educational, civic, cultural and economic development goals of their communities.
